The channel-forming diglycolylated heptapeptides containing the amino acid sequence Gly-Gly-Gly-Pro-Gly-Gly-Gly have been found to complex chloride in CDCl3. The strength of the interaction depends on the terminal alkyl groups and on chloride's countercation.
